On An Average Day You Will:
(includes, but not limited to)

Make a true difference-one patient, one family, one compassionate moment at a time.
  • Develop and implement individualized care plans based on current and prior medical history
  • Deliver attentive, one-on-one support to patients and their families, ensuring comfort, dignity, and understanding
  • Conduct thorough assessments of physical, emotional, and spiritual needs throughout the care journey
  • Accurately monitor and document vital signs including temperature, pulse, respiration, and blood pressure
  • Administer physician-ordered medications and treatments with skill and empathy
  • Educate patients and their families on care techniques and symptom management
  • Track and communicate changes in patient condition, ensuring timely and effective responses
  • Keep detailed and up-to-date clinical notes to reflect patient progress and quality of care provided
  •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to ensure comprehensive care delivery
  • And contribute to other supportive duties as part of a compassionate, mission-driven team
  • And additional duties as assigned
What You'll Bring to The Team:
  • A heart for hospice care and a commitment to exceptional service
  • A valid Registered Nurse license in good standing in the state you will work in
  • A valid driver's license and reliable transportation
  • CPR certification (current)
  • Strong observational and communication skills-both written and verbal
  • A flexible, team-oriented attitude and willingness to support additional duties as needed
